Abstract


The present work aimed at studying the mode of action of different concentrations of BR (3, 6, 12 and 24 μM) or JA (1, 10, 20 and 40μM) as seed soaking or foliar spraying on certain morphological criteria, metabolic activities and yield of Vicia faba plan
